Skip site navigation (1)Skip section navigation (2)
Date:      Sat, 30 Jan 2016 18:05:37 +0000 (UTC)
From:      Thomas Zander <riggs@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r407536 - head/games/retroarch
Message-ID:  <201601301805.u0UI5bYU012386@repo.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: riggs
Date: Sat Jan 30 18:05:37 2016
New Revision: 407536
URL: https://svnweb.freebsd.org/changeset/ports/407536

Log:
  Fix missing dependencies, correct USE_PYTHON
  
  PR:		206010
  Submitted by:	yuri@rawbw.com (maintainer)
  MFH:		2016Q1

Modified:
  head/games/retroarch/Makefile

Modified: head/games/retroarch/Makefile
==============================================================================
--- head/games/retroarch/Makefile	Sat Jan 30 16:53:28 2016	(r407535)
+++ head/games/retroarch/Makefile	Sat Jan 30 18:05:37 2016	(r407536)
@@ -4,6 +4,7 @@
 PORTNAME=	RetroArch
 PORTVERSION=	1.2.2
 DISTVERSIONPREFIX=	v
+PORTREVISION=	1
 CATEGORIES=	games
 
 MAINTAINER=	yuri@rawbw.com
@@ -12,7 +13,8 @@ COMMENT=	Cross-platform entertainment sy
 LICENSE=	GPLv3
 LICENSE_FILE=	${WRKSRC}/COPYING
 
-LIB_DEPENDS=	libxkbcommon.so:${PORTSDIR}/x11/libxkbcommon
+LIB_DEPENDS=	libxkbcommon.so:${PORTSDIR}/x11/libxkbcommon \
+		libdrm.so:${PORTSDIR}/graphics/libdrm
 
 OPTIONS_DEFINE=	FFMPEG OSS JACK PULSEAUDIO ALSA SDL OPENGL OPENAL NETPLAY PYTHON V4L FREETYPE FBO
 OPTIONS_DEFAULT=FFMPEG OSS PULSEAUDIO SDL OPENGL OPENAL NETPLAY PYTHON V4L FREETYPE FBO
@@ -33,14 +35,15 @@ ALSA_CONFIGURE_ENABLE=	alsa
 SDL_USE=		SDL=sdl2 image2
 SDL_CONFIGURE_ON=	--disable-sdl --enable-sdl2
 SDL_CONFIGURE_OFF=	--disable-sdl --disable-sdl2
-OPENGL_USE=		GL=gl
+OPENGL_USE=		GL=gl,gbm
 OPENGL_CONFIGURE_ENABLE=opengl
 OPENAL_USES=		openal:soft
 OPENAL_CONFIGURE_ENABLE=al
 NETPLAY_CONFIGURE_ENABLE=	netplay
 PYTHON_CONFIGURE_ENABLE=python
-PYTHON_USES=		python:3.4+
+PYTHON_USES=		python:3
 V4L_LIB_DEPENDS=	libv4l2.so:${PORTSDIR}/multimedia/libv4l
+V4L_BUILD_DEPENDS=	v4l_compat>0:${PORTSDIR}/multimedia/v4l_compat
 V4L_CONFIGURE_ENABLE=	v4l2
 FREETYPE_LIB_DEPENDS=	libfreetype.so:${PORTSDIR}/print/freetype2
 FREETYPE_CONFIGURE_ENABLE=	freetype
@@ -56,7 +59,7 @@ GH_ACCOUNT=	libretro
 SUB_FILES=	pkg-message
 GNU_CONFIGURE=	yes
 CONFIGURE_ARGS+=--global-config-dir=${LOCALBASE}/etc
-USES=		compiler:c++11-lib gmake
+USES=		compiler:c++11-lib gmake pkgconfig
 USE_XORG=	x11 xext xinerama xv xxf86vm
 
 MAN1PAGES=	retroarch-cg2glsl.1 retroarch-joyconfig.1 retroarch.1



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201601301805.u0UI5bYU012386>